Abstract

The utility model discloses a flange, which belongs to the technical field of flanges and comprises a first flange plate and a second flange plate, wherein annular grooves are formed in the outer walls of one side of the first flange plate and the outer walls of one side of the second flange plate, sealing rings are embedded between the inner parts of the two annular grooves, butt joint grooves are formed in the outer walls of one side of the first flange plate, butt joint bosses are correspondingly and fixedly connected to the outer walls of one side of the second flange plate, protruding blocks are fixedly connected to the outer walls of two sides of the butt joint bosses, arc grooves of the outer walls of two sides of the first flange plate and the second flange plate are used for installing the sealing rings, the connecting sealing effect of the first flange plate and the second flange plate is improved through the sealing rings, the first flange plate and the second flange plate are conveniently and rapidly butted through the butt joint grooves and the butt joint bosses, the first flange plate and the second flange plate are prevented from being relatively rotated through the protruding blocks and the grooves, and the butt joint effect and stability of the first flange plate and the second flange plate are further improved through positioning holes.

Background
The flange, namely flange disc or flange, is a part for connecting shafts, is used for connecting pipe ends, is also used for connecting equipment inlets and outlets, is used for connecting two equipment, such as a speed reducer flange, a flange connection or a flange joint, and is used for connecting the flange, a gasket and a bolt to form a detachable connection of a group of combined sealing structures, and the pipeline flange is used for connecting pipes in a pipeline device and is used for connecting equipment inlets and outlets.
The utility model discloses a flange convenient to install, which comprises a first flange plate, wherein an axial channel I is formed in the central position of the outer side of the first flange plate, a connector I is fixedly connected to the outer side of the axial channel I, regular hexagon grooves are uniformly formed in the periphery of the connector I, the regular hexagon grooves are formed in the outer side of the first flange plate, a first screw hole is formed in an inner cavity of the regular hexagon grooves, the flange is simple in structure and convenient to use, when the flange is fixed, the head of a hexagonal bolt can be clamped, only a spanner is needed to be used for screwing a nut, the installation step is reduced, the installation efficiency is improved, the connection tightness between the two flange plates can be improved, the sealing performance of the flange is improved, the two flange plates can be preliminarily fixed, the two flange plates cannot rotate relatively, so that the first screw hole and the second screw hole keep an aligned state, and the two flange plates are further pressed through the nut and the hexagonal bolt.
The regular hexagon groove of adaptation bolt head is set up on the ring flange in above-mentioned patent, can improve screw tightening efficiency, but fix a position two ring flanges through reference column and constant head tank in the above-mentioned patent, increased the installation step of flange, owing to can realize the location to two ring flanges at two relative silk hollow internally mounted upper bolts, and the bolt still need not take off after the installation, consequently carry out the location of ring flange through reference column and constant head tank and undoubtedly reduced the installation effectiveness of flange.

Detailed Description
The technical solutions in the embodiments of the present utility model will be clearly and completely described below with reference to the drawings in the embodiments of the present utility model. It is apparent that the described embodiments are only some embodiments of the present utility model, not all embodiments, and that all other embodiments obtained by persons of ordinary skill in the art without making creative efforts based on the embodiments in the present utility model are within the protection scope of the present utility model.
Examples:
referring to fig. 1-3, a flange, comprising:
ring flange 1 and ring flange 2, ring flange 1 and ring flange 2 one side outer wall all have been seted up the ring channel, inlay between two ring channel inside and have been equipped with sealing washer 3, ring flange 1 one side outer wall has been seted up butt joint recess 4, ring flange 2 one side outer wall corresponds fixedly connected with butt joint boss 5, the equal fixedly connected with lug 6 of butt joint boss 5 both sides outer wall, recess 7 has all been seted up in the equal correspondence of butt joint recess 4 both sides inner wall, a plurality of locating holes 8 have been seted up to ring flange 1 and ring flange 2 one side outer wall.
In the embodiment, the arc groove of the outer wall of one side opposite to the flange plate 1 and the flange plate 2 is used for installing the sealing ring 3, the connection sealing effect of the flange plate 1 and the flange plate 2 is improved through the sealing ring 3, the flange plate 1 and the flange plate 2 are conveniently and rapidly butted through the matching of the butting groove 4 and the butting boss 5, the flange plate 1 and the flange plate 2 are prevented from being deviated, meanwhile, the flange plate 1 and the flange plate 2 are prevented from relatively rotating through the matching of the protruding block 6 and the groove 7, the butting effect and the stability of the flange plate 1 and the flange plate 2 are further improved, and the flange plate 1 and the flange plate 2 are conveniently installed through the positioning hole 8.
Referring to fig. 1 specifically, the outer walls of one side of the first flange plate 1 and one side of the second flange plate 2 are provided with U-shaped mounting holes 9.
In this embodiment, U type mounting hole 9 makes things convenient for running through of instruments such as rope or steel wire, through at U type mounting hole 9 internally mounted rope or steel wire, conveniently hoist and mount flange dish one 1 and flange dish two 2, promotes the installation effectiveness of flange dish one 1 and flange dish two 2 then.
Referring to fig. 1-3 specifically, a locking bolt 10 is embedded in each positioning hole 8, and a locking nut 11 is screwed on the outer surface of each locking bolt 10.
In the embodiment, the locking bolt 10 and the locking nut 11 are matched, so that the first flange plate 1 and the second flange plate 2 are conveniently locked and installed.
Referring to fig. 2 specifically, shaft holes 12 are formed in the centers of the outer walls of one side of the first flange plate 1 and one side of the second flange plate 2, and the diameters of the two shaft holes 12 are identical.
In this embodiment, the shaft hole 12 is conveniently used for the circulation of the pipe circulation.
Referring to fig. 1-3, the outer walls of one side of the first flange plate 1 and one side of the second flange plate 2 are fixedly connected with a connecting portion 13.
In this embodiment, the first flange 1 and the second flange 2 are conveniently installed and connected with the corresponding pipeline through the connecting part 13.
Referring specifically to fig. 2, a flange gasket 14 is disposed between the outer walls of the first flange 1 and the second flange 2.
In this embodiment, the connection sealing effect of the first flange plate 1 and the second flange plate 2 is further improved by the flange gasket 14.
Working principle: when the flange plate I1 and the flange plate II 2 are higher in installation position, the rope penetrates through the U-shaped installation hole 9, the flange plate I1 and the flange plate II 2 are conveniently hoisted, the sealing ring 3 is embedded into any annular groove on the flange plate I1 and the flange plate II 2, the flange gasket 14 is attached between the flange plate I1 and the flange plate II 2, the flange plate I1 and the flange plate II 2 are attached, the butt joint boss 5 is inserted into the butt joint groove 4, meanwhile, the lug boss 6 is inserted into the corresponding groove 7, and the flange plate I1 and the flange plate II 2 are locked by the locking bolt 10 and the locking nut 11.
